The personal consumption expenditures (PCE) index, closely watched by the Federal Reserve, rose at an annualized clip of 3.8% in April, the fastest pace since May 2023. Even when food and energy prices were stripped out of the measurement, the index rose 3.3% last month compared to a year ago—the highest level since November 2023.
